#da6149 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da6149 is composed of 85.5% red, 38%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 57.1%. #da6149 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c292 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#da6149 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da6149 has RGB values of R:218, G:97,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.67,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14311753.
| Hex triplet | da6149 | #da6149 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 218, 97, 73 | rgb(218,97,73) |
| RGB Percent | 85.5, 38, 28.6 | rgb(85.5%,38%,28.6%) |
| CMYK | 0, 56, 67, 15 | |
| HSL | 9.9°, 66.2, 57.1 | hsl(9.9,66.2%,57.1%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 9.9°, 66.5, 85.5 | |
| Web Safe | cc6633 | #cc6633 |
| CIE-LAB | 56.027, 45.834, 36.701 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 34.392, 23.939, 9.113 |
| xyY | 0.51, 0.355, 23.939 |
| CIE-LCH | 56.027, 58.717, 38.686 |
| CIE-LUV | 56.027, 94.005, 31.792 |
| Hunter-Lab | 48.928, 39.847, 23.207 |
| Binary | 11011010, 01100001, 01001001 |
